Property Overview
This is a three-bedroom, living-dining-kitchen (3LDK) detached house located in Oaza Nagaoka, Ibaraki Town, Higashiibaraki District, Ibaraki Prefecture. The property is priced at 24,990,000 yen and is available for immediate occupancy. It was constructed in May 2013 by Ichijo Komuten, a well-known home builder. The house features an all-electric system with floor heating and a solar power generation system.
The property sits on a corner lot with a land area of 223 square meters (approximately 67.45 tsubo) and a building area of 90.94 square meters (approximately 27.50 tsubo). The structure is a two-story wooden building. The layout includes a Japanese-style room (washitsu), a system kitchen, a bathroom with a dryer, a shower-equipped vanity, two toilets with heated washlet seats, a walk-in closet, and a balcony. The property also has a garden and parking space for two cars. The front road is over 6 meters wide, with a 5.9-meter-wide road to the west and an 8.1-meter-wide road to the north. The property is connected to public water and main sewer systems.
The property is located in a quiet residential area in Ibaraki Town. The nearest train station is Mito Station on the JR Joban Line, which is approximately a 99-minute walk away. Other nearby stations include Kairakuen Station and Akatsuka Station, also on the JR Joban Line, each about a 99-minute walk. A supermarket is within a 10-minute walk. The property falls under a Category 1 Low-Rise Residential Zone with a building coverage ratio of 50% and a floor area ratio of 100%.
